New York State Common Retirement Fund has agreed to commit $300 million to North Haven Infrastructure Partners III, according to the pension’s September meeting minutes. The fund managed by Morgan Stanley will focus on the acquisition of private infrastructure assets with the potential for value creation through active management. Target transactions will be located primarily within developed countries and sector focus includes: renewables, transportation, and digital infrastructure.
The $210.20 billion US public pension has a 1.0 percent allocation to infrastructure.
